Output d86d71167663b263dcb47dcaa2eaa8d47de4dc4e10abc55bd67de5bd86cbaf0d:1

value
1253000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e889b1deae91d7e872a88ac72a119513420bbcec OP_EQUAL
address
3NtZeFX37vjiSAgnds1Gc749FWUEUP33bq
transaction
d86d71167663b263dcb47dcaa2eaa8d47de4dc4e10abc55bd67de5bd86cbaf0d
confirmations
355733
spent
true